Field fence repair services involve restoring and maintaining fencing systems that are used to enclose properties, livestock, or specific areas. These services typically include fixing damaged or broken fence panels, replacing worn-out posts, tightening loose wires, and addressing issues caused by weather or pests. Skilled contractors assess the condition of the existing fencing, identify weak spots or areas of failure, and perform necessary repairs to ensure the fence functions effectively and maintains its structural integrity.
This service helps solve common problems such as sagging sections, broken or missing wires, leaning posts, and rusted or corroded components. Over time, fences can become compromised due to exposure to the elements or physical impacts, leading to reduced security, containment issues, or aesthetic concerns. Repairing damaged fencing helps property owners restore the barrier’s effectiveness, prevent unauthorized access, and maintain a neat appearance without the need for complete replacement.

The overview below groups typical Field Fence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Canton,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Perimeter Fence Repair - Costs typically range from $200 to $1,000 depending on the length and extent of damage, with minor repairs around $200 and more extensive fixes up to $1,000 for larger sections.
Post Replacement - Replacing damaged or rotted fence posts can cost between $50 and $150 per post, including materials and labor, depending on post size and accessibility.
Wire Replacement - Replacing sections of damaged wire generally costs $1 to $3 per linear foot, with total expenses varying based on the total length of fencing needing repair.
Complete Fence Restoration - Full restoration services may range from $1,500 to $5,000 or more, depending on the size of the area and the scope of repairs required by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my field fence needs repair? Signs such as sagging, broken wires, or gaps indicate that repair may be necessary. A local fence professional can assess the condition of the fence to determine needed repairs.
What types of damage can be repaired on field fences? Common damages include broken or bent wires, loose posts, and holes. Skilled contractors can address these issues to restore fence integrity.
How long does field fence repair typically take? Repair du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but a local service provider can provide an estimate based on the specific situation.
Are there different repair options for various fence materials? Yes, repair methods depend on the fence material, such as woven wire or barbed wire, and a professional can recommend suitable solutions.
